Our Virtual Mental Health Services

Virtual Counseling

Talk with a licensed therapist or counselor about everyday struggles and personal challenges. Sessions are tailored to your needs and clinically appropriate for your situation.


Common concerns:

stress, anxiety, depression, relationship issues, parenting struggles, grief, or substance use.

Virtual Psychology

Meet one-on-one with a licensed psychologist for a deeper assessment of your symptoms, medical history, and life circumstances. Together, you’ll create a personalized plan for long-term wellness.


Common concerns:

depression, major life changes, grief and loss, addiction, stress management, or relationship challenges.

Virtual Psychiatry
